Here are some random facts for you:
1. Britney Spears is an anagram for 'Presbyterians.' (She's not Presbyterian, though. She was raised Baptist and now practices Kabbalah.)
2. The fourth president, James Madison, and the 12th president, Zachary Taylor, were second cousins. That makes them closer than Teddy Roosevelt and FDR, who were fifth cousins.
3. Studies have found the middle stall in a public bathroom is usually the dirtiest the first stall is the cleanest.
4. The first time Google changed its logo to one of its 'doodles' was August 30th, 1998, six days before they even incorporated the company. The doodle was in honor of Burning Man which is where the two founders were going that weekend.
5. Manute Bol who was 7-foot-7 is the only player in NBA history with more blocked shots in his career than points.
